Overview of Texas Instruments TPS22919DCKT
The TPS22919DCKT is a high-performance, single-channel load switch from Texas Instruments, designed for power management applications. This compact and efficient component is a crucial part of modern electronic systems, providing a means to control power distribution with precision and reliability.
Key Features
- Ultra-Low On-Resistance: The TPS22919DCKT boasts an ultra-low on-resistance (RON) of just 28 mΩ at a 5V gate drive, which minimizes power loss and improves efficiency in power management systems.
- Input Voltage Range: It operates over a wide input voltage range from 0.6V to 5.5V, making it suitable for various applications, including those powered by Li-Ion batteries or 5V power rails.
- Quick Output Discharge: The device features a quick output discharge transistor, which ensures a rapid power-down of the load when the switch is turned off, enhancing system safety and preventing unwanted power consumption.
- Low Quiescent Current: It has a low quiescent current of 20 µA (typical), which is particularly beneficial for battery-powered devices, extending their operational life by reducing standby power consumption.
- Controlled Slew Rate: The TPS22919DCKT includes a controlled slew rate to mitigate inrush current, thereby reducing noise and potential damage to sensitive electronic components.

Package and Reliability
The device comes in a compact 6-pin SC-70 (SOT-323) package, which is highly valued in space-constrained applications. Additionally, the TPS22919DCKT is characterized for operation over the free-air temperature range of -40°C to 85°C, ensuring reliable performance across a broad spectrum of environmental conditions.
